N2 - Aim of this study was to prove the clinical value of nuclear medicine procedures to detect the sentinel lymph node (SLN) for SLN biopsy. METHODS: In 132 patients with breast cancer we performed lymph scintigraphy of the breast as well as both pre- and intraoperative gamma probe measurements correlating the results with the findings of histopathology. RESULTS: SLN were detectable in 62 of 110 patients according to a sensitivity of 56% when scanning was performed only at 1-2 h p.i. while the sensitivity increased to 86% (19 of 22 pts.) if sequential images were acquired up to 2 h p.i. One or more SLN were identified by a hand-held gamma probe transcutaneously prior to surgery in 96% (113 of 118 pts.) of the patients who showed up with no clinically suspected lymph node metastases. Intraoperatively, in additionally 2 patients the SLN could be found resulting in a sensitivity of 97% (115 of 118 pts.). In only 3 patients with clinically no tumor spread to axillary lymph nodes no SLN could be identified by the probe. Skip lesions, i.e. lymph node metastases in patients with tumor-free SLN, occurred in 2 cases: due to SLN biopsy in these patients lymph node staging was false negative compared to conventional staging by means of axillary lymph node dissection. CONCLUSION: The results demonstrate a high preoperative detection rate of SLN in patients with breast cancer using lymph scintigraphy and gamma probe measurements. Thus, nuclear medicine is capable of providing the basic requirements for SLN biopsy in the daily routine.
